Есть ли какой-либо путь, как я могу получить доступ к веб-сервису от GWT использование его WSDL? Ранее я пытался использовать сгенерированные классы от ws-импорта...., но затем кто-то указал мне, что GWT не может обработать весь Java, просто подмножество его, следовательно он не поймет классы ws-импорта.
Спасибо и наилучшие пожелания, Krt_Malta
GWT может обращаться к веб-службам с помощью RequestBuilder , который выполняет HTTP-вызовы службы и затем получает доступ к ее ответу.
Поскольку ваша веб-служба использует протокол SOAP, ответ, который вы получите в обратном вызове RequestBuilder, будет XML. Разберите этот XML, чтобы найти интересующую вас информацию, и все готово.
В нашем проекте мы использовали Axis Client для вызова веб-службы SOAP (WSDL Driven). Для создания клиента с использованием предоставленного WTP/ AXIS Webservice в Spring Source Tool мы использовали инструмент inbuild plug tool. Мы использовали тот же код клиента для включения в GWT, и все работает нормально.